diff options
| author | 2025-03-05 12:50:40 -0800 | |
|---|---|---|
| committer | 2025-03-05 12:50:40 -0800 | |
| commit | a6972a269bdd0961f12545474182f753a8e17c6e (patch) | |
| tree | d567fbc5309615b4769b0593f6264ff201c47cd6 | |
| parent | 684e4e11c31abbeea72e550c38abe947814b1e3b (diff) | |
| parent | c28514dea5b7639633a3e5ebd8575912a4bba081 (diff) | |
Merge "Fail to create QuickAccessWalletServiceInfo when there is no default wallet" into main
| -rw-r--r-- | core/java/android/service/quickaccesswallet/QuickAccessWalletServiceInfo.java |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/core/java/android/service/quickaccesswallet/QuickAccessWalletServiceInfo.java b/core/java/android/service/quickaccesswallet/QuickAccessWalletServiceInfo.java index e1dc6f6d642b..e9ddfc3559bf 100644 --- a/core/java/android/service/quickaccesswallet/QuickAccessWalletServiceInfo.java +++ b/core/java/android/service/quickaccesswallet/QuickAccessWalletServiceInfo.java @@ -96,6 +96,10 @@ class QuickAccessWalletServiceInfo { defaultAppPackageName = defaultPaymentApp.getPackageName(); } + if (defaultAppPackageName == null || defaultAppUser < 0) { + return null; + } + ServiceInfo serviceInfo = getWalletServiceInfo(context, defaultAppPackageName, defaultAppUser); if (serviceInfo == null) { |